Subject: Re: [PATCH] bfa: turn bfa_mem_{kva,dma}_setup into inline functions

On Wed, Nov 16, 2016 at 04:14:27PM +0100, Arnd Bergmann wrote:
> These two macros cause lots of warnings with gcc-7:
> 
> drivers/scsi/bfa/bfa_svc.c: In function 'bfa_fcxp_meminfo':
> drivers/scsi/bfa/bfa_svc.c:521:103: error: '*' in boolean context, 
> suggest '&&' instead [-Werror=int-in-bool-context]
> 
> Using inline functions makes them much more readable and avoids the 
> warnings.
